Hungary's Ministry of Energy published the 2026 heat pump call on April 10. Direct non-repayable grant replaces the prior VAT-refund scheme.
Maximum is 2M HUF (~€5,000), covering up to 50% of investment. Air-water pump + solar combinations get the top tier.
Deadline: October 31, 2026 or until the 25 billion HUF budget is exhausted — expected in 3-4 months based on prior rounds.
